具体需求:部门管理中,有git服务器,部门管理系统的服务器,vpn 服务器等等,每一个访问都是用ip,这样很烦,不高大上,我想整成这样:git服务器:git.com 管理系统的服务器:mag.com… 的形式。
解决方法:新建一个虚拟机(这里是ubuntu 16.04 64位),搭建成一个dns服务器,然后让部门的每一台电脑的dns指向dns服务器,就可以了。
环境(都是ubuntu16.04 64位):我的git服务器: 10.10.3.155
管理系统所在的服务器:10.10.3.154
新建的dns服务器:10.10.3.153
现在开始搭建dns服务器(10.10.3.153)
1.更新环境,切换成root用户
su root
apt-get update
2.安装bind9
apt-get install bind9
3.配置/etc/bind/named.conf.local 文件(服务器域解析文件)
zone "mag.com"{
type master;
file "db.mag.com";
};
zone "git.com"{
type master